Delhi – Gurugram 6/8 Lane Expressway Project, India

Design/ Construction Supervision for Strengthening and widening of 6/8 lane Delhi – Gurgaon Expressway Project, Length-28 Kms., Construction Cost – US$ 128 Million, Delhi and Haryana, India

A multimillion-Rupee fast track Design/Construction supervision Project for Conversion of Delhi Gurgaon Section Of NH-8 into a Access Controlled Eight/Six Lane Expressway with service lanes along certain sections and strengthening and widening of the existing lanes from Km 14.30 to Km 42.00 falling partly in Delhi and partly in Haryana. The project stretch has 8 flyovers with an aggregate length of approx. 8.4 km including the approaches. The project is developed on a build, operate and transfer basis and the Concessionaire for the project is Jaypee DSC Ventures Limited working

for the National Highways Authority of India. One of the challenges on the project is the tight schedule; the project is to be completed in 24 months with 6 months for design and 18 months for construction. The other challenge is unimpeded flow of traffic during construction. Many VIP’s travel the route so the security measures have to be in place throughout the construction period.
